Sample at the Avery tap room/brewery. This brew pours a cloudy lemonade color with a thin white head that burns away to a residual film. Spotty lacing on the glass. Aroma of lemons and wheat. Light, clean body with a citrusy character and flavors of wheat and banana, plus a touch of clove. The finish is wheaty with a fruity aftertaste. Decent collaboration brew overall.

Bomber - turbid, glowing orange, with a huge, well-sustained, frothy head - yup, she looks purdy - clove, bubblegum, banana, some floral notes in the nose, some earthy wheat - full mouthfeel, medium-soft carbonation - moderate sweetness - tangy/tart character - a tad bit spicy, with some peppery alcohol heat on the tail end of things - clove and banana are there, but are fairly subdued - fairly refreshing for it’s strength, but hefty enough to keep you from drinking it too fast - not bad.
